As the cryptocurrency sector gears up for the 2026 midterm elections, it is entering the year with a substantial financial reserve of over $193 million. This strategic positioning highlights the industry's commitment to influencing political outcomes that could impact its future, and the source reports that this financial backing could play a crucial role in shaping the electoral landscape.

Fairshake's Political Focus

Fairshake, the foremost super Political Action Committee (PAC) associated with the crypto industry, is actively identifying key races to support. Among its priorities is Republican Representative Barry Moore, who is running for a Senate seat in Alabama. The PAC is also targeting Democratic Representative Al Green in Texas, aiming to unseat him in the upcoming elections.

Strategic Financial Mobilization

This approach reflects the industry's tactics from the 2024 elections, where significant financial resources were mobilized to sway critical races. With ongoing discussions surrounding regulatory clarity, the cryptocurrency sector is determined to safeguard its interests in Washington, ensuring that its voice is heard in the political arena.
